PAPERS HAVING CONNECTIONS TO THESE IDEAS

Ideas and Graphs (2018)
An exposition of the relation of graph theory to Bennett's systematics, primarily his tetrad.

Mind and Life: Is the Materialist Neo-Darwinian Conception of Nature False? (2016)
A discussion of 'mind' that utilizes Bennett's scheme of automatic/sensitive/conscious energies.

Freedom as a Natural Phenomenon (201S)
A characterization of 'freedom' using Bennett's 3-2-1 triad and these three energies.

Levels of Altruism (2014)
Types of altruism schematized using the octave.

Complexity Theory and Political Change: Talcott Parsons Occupies Wall Street (2014)
Similarity of Parsons' "action" to Bennett's tetrad; some political implications.
